Abstract
A transportation fixture for holding a substrate rack comprises top and bottom endplates that are attached by a plurality of posts. The posts are spaced apart a sufficient distance to confine a substrate rack between the posts. Each post has a longitudinal inside edge with a compliant bumper that cushions the substrate rack. A transportation shell at least a portion of which is light permeable, can enclose the fixture to allow viewing of the fixture and rack, without opening the shell. An exterior hard casing can enclose the shell for further protection.
Claims
exact text as granted — not AI-modified1 . A transportation fixture for holding a substrate rack, the transportation fixture comprising:
(a) top and bottom endplates; (b) a plurality of posts attaching the top endplate to the bottom endplate, the posts spaced apart a sufficient distance to confine the substrate rack therebetween, each post having a longitudinal inside edge; and (c) a plurality of compliant bumpers that are each coupled to a longitudinal inside edge of a post.
2 . A transportation fixture according to claim 1 wherein the posts are joined to the endplate by a pin that forms a hinge.
3 . A fixture according to claim 1 wherein the top and bottom endplates are triangular.
4 . A fixture according to claim 3 wherein the triangular endplates have apexes, and wherein the posts are joined to the apexes.
5 . A fixture according to claim 3 wherein the triangular endplates have slots at their apexes that are sized to receive the posts.
6 . A fixture according to claim 5 wherein a triangular endplate comprises a pair of hinge blocks disposed about one of the slots, the pair of hinge blocks having facing sidewalls that include holes that align with a hole in the post to allow a pin to be passed through the aligned holes to hold the post to the endplate.
7 . A fixture according to claim 1 wherein the top and bottom endplates include reinforcing structures.
8 . A fixture according to claim 7 wherein the reinforcing structures comprise finger-holds for carrying the fixture.
9 . A fixture according to claim 1 wherein each compliant bumper comprises a polymer tube.
10 . A fixture according to claim 9 wherein each polymer tube includes a textured surface.
11 . A fixture according to claim 1 wherein each post comprises a pair of strips that house a rod.
12 . A fixture according to claim 1 wherein the top and bottom endplates, the posts, and the compliant bumpers are made from a non-metallic and heat-resistant material.
13 . A transportation package comprising the fixture of claim 1 enclosed in a shell, at least a portion of the shell being light permeable.
14 . A transportation package according to claim 13 wherein the shell comprises a pair of opposing trays.
15 . A transportation package according to claim 14 wherein the trays each have a closed end and an open end with a circumferential lip, and wherein the trays are joined at their circumferential lips so that their open ends face each other.
16 . A transportation package according to claim 13 wherein the shell comprises an exhaust port coupling and a purge gas coupling.
17 . A transportation package according to claim 13 further comprising a hard casing having a foam interior to receive the shell.
18 . A transportation fixture for holding a substrate rack, the transportation fixture comprising:
(a) top and bottom endplates that are triangular and have apexes; (b) three posts that attach to the apexes of the top and bottom endplates; and (c) a compliant bumper coupled to each post.
19 . A fixture according to claim 18 wherein the endplates further comprise reinforcing structures having cut-out handles.
20 . A fixture according to claim 18 wherein the endplates have slots at their apexes that are sized to receive the posts.
21 . A fixture according to claim 18 wherein each endplate comprises a pair of hinge blocks disposed about a slot, the hinge blocks having facing sidewalls that include holes that align with a hole in the post to allow a pin to be passed through the aligned holes to hold the post to the endplate.
22 . A transportation package comprising the fixture of claim 18 enclosed in a shell having at least a portion which is light permeable.
23 . A transportation package according to claim 22 further comprising a hard casing having a foam interior to receive the shell.
24 . A transportation shell comprising:
(a) a first tray having a closed end and an open end with a first circumferential lip, at least a portion of the first tray comprising a light permeable material; (b) a second tray comprising a closed end and an open end with a second circumferential lip, at least a portion of the second tray comprising a light permeable material, and wherein the second circumferential lip mates with the first circumferential lip such that the open ends of the first and second trays face each other; and (c) a sealing gasket between the first and second circumferential lips to form a seal therebetween.
25 . A shell according to claim 24 wherein first and second trays comprise cylinders.
26 . A shell according to claim 24 wherein circumferential lips extend outwardly, and transversely, from the shells.
27 . A shell according to claim 24 comprising an exhaust port coupling and a purge gas coupling.
28 . A shell according to claim 24 wherein the light permeable material comprises a visible light transmission percentage of at least about 20%.
29 . A shell according to claim 24 wherein the light permeable material comprises a heat setting thermoplastic polymer.
30 . A shell according to claim 24 wherein the light permeable material comprises polyethylene terephthalate (PET), glycol-modified PET (PETG), oriented PET (O-PET), polyethylene naphthalate (PEN), or blends thereof with each other or with other resins.
31 . A shell according to claim 24 wherein the light permeable material comprises polyethylene terephthalate glycol.
32 . A transportation package comprising the shell of claim 24 and further comprising a hard casing having a foam interior to receive the shell.
33 . A method of manufacturing the shell of claim 24 by molding the first and second trays using thermoforming methods.
34 . A method according to claim 33 comprising molding each of the first and second trays as integral pieces from a single sheet of thermoplastic material.
35 . A transportation package for transporting a substrate processing substrate rack, the transportation package comprising:
(a) a shell comprising a pair of opposing trays that each have a closed end and an open end with a circumferential lip, the trays being joined at their circumferential lips to define a cavity inside the shell; and (b) a transportation fixture inside the cavity, the transportation fixture comprising:
(i) top and bottom endplates; and
(ii) a plurality of spaced apart posts attaching the top endplate to the bottom endplate to confine the substrate rack therebetween, each post having a longitudinal inside edge; and
(iii) a plurality of compliant bumpers that are each coupled to a longitudinal inside edges of a post.
36 . A transportation package according to claim 35 wherein the top and bottom endplates are triangular and have apexes, and wherein the posts are each joined to an apex of a triangular plate.
37 . A transportation package according to claim 35 further comprising a hard casing having a foam interior to receive the shell.
38 . A transportation package for transporting a substrate processing substrate rack, the transportation package comprising:
(a) a rigid casing having an interior foam block that is contoured to match the shape of a shell; and (b) a shell that fits in the contoured interior foam block, the shell comprising:
(i) a first tray having a closed end and an open end with a first circumferential lip, at least a portion of the first tray comprising a light permeable material;
(ii) a second tray comprising a closed end and an open end with a second circumferential lip, at least a portion of the second tray comprising a light permeable material, and wherein the second circumferential lip mates with the first circumferential lip such that the open ends of the first and second trays face each other to define a cavity sized to receive a transportation fixture; and
(iii) a sealing gasket between the first and second circumferential lips to form a seal therebetween
39 . A transportation package according to claim 38 wherein first and second trays comprise cylinders.
40 . A transportation package according to claim 38 wherein the circumferential lips extend outwardly, and transversely, from the shells.
41 . A transportation package according to claim 38 wherein the shell comprises an exhaust port coupling and a purge gas coupling.
42 . A transportation package according to claim 38 wherein the light permeable material comprises a visible light transmission percentage of at least about 20%.
43 . A transportation package according to claim 38 wherein the light permeable material comprises polyethylene terephthalate glycol.
